House Minority Leader Hakeem Jeffries (D-N.Y.) has recently made a bold statement regarding the ongoing turmoil over immigration enforcement in Minnesota. In a post on the social platform X, Jeffries threatened to lead impeachment proceedings against Department of Homeland Security (DHS) Secretary Kristi Noem if President Trump does not fire her immediately.
The Democratic leader’s statement comes as a response to the controversial tactics employed by the DHS in Minnesota, which have sparked outrage and protests across the country. The department has been accused of using excessive force and violating the rights of immigrants, leading to a call for Noem’s resignation.
In his post, Jeffries did not mince his words, stating that “Donald Trump must fire Kristi Noem immediately.” He also warned that if the President fails to take action, Democrats will not hesitate to initiate impeachment proceedings against Noem.
